Hwange Colliery Boss In Mysterious Death

By- Hwange community has been plunged into mourning following the sudden death of Hwange Colliery Company Limited (HCCL) managing director, Dr Charles Zinyemba.

He was 59.

Dr Zinyemba collapsed and died at his home in the mining town on Sunday morning and details leading to his death are still sketchy.

Announcing his death to workers in an internal memo, HCCL said: “It is with a heavy heart that we announce the death of our managing director Dr C Zinyemba. Dr Zinyemba passed away in the early hours of Sunday.
“Further information and funeral arrangements will be shared soon. In the meantime, the administration team joins the Zinyemba family, HCCL employees and the entire Hwange community to mourn a pillar in the company and community. May his soul rest in peace.”
A sombre atmosphere swept across Hwange yesterday as workers, business leaders and members of community paid tribute to the late HCCL managing director during a funeral service held at the Colliery Stadium.
Speaker after speaker praised Dr Zinyemba for his transformative dedication towards the company’s turnaround efforts. The company’s administrator, Mr Dale Sibanda, said Dr Zinyemba was a hard worker.
“We appointed him substantive managing director and since that appointment not one day did he disappoint. Dr Zinyemba has been with HCCL for over 10 years.
He knew and had an understanding of HCCL history,” he said.
“He understood clearly where we are now and saw clearly our vision for the future.
He was an integral part of the process to rebuild the company and provided vital guidance to the administration team.
He would use his vast knowledge to shepherd us away from retrogressive moves.”
In 2020, during a tour of Chaba Mine by President Emmerson Mnangagwa, Dr Zinyemba told the President that HCCL was in a state of collapse at the start of administration in October 2018, as creditors were swooping on it through a string of litigations.
Workers had also gone for several months without pay.
Workers who spoke to Business Chronicle expressed shock over Dr Zinyemba’s death and paid tribute to his legacy.
“He was a good man who despite being a medical doctor steered the achievements that we are now experiencing at the colliery,” said Mr Wilfred Teera.
“The turnaround that is currently being experienced is because of his leadership and dedication.
He managed to bring in the equipment including boosting workers welfare.”
Another worker, Mrs Florence Mudenda, said Dr Zinyemba had workers’ wellbeing at heart.
“When the late Dr Zinyemba took the reins even in an acting capacity, changes began to be felt in the company especially amongst workers,” she said.
“One of his goals was workers’ welfare. For the first time after years, we began to get our salaries on time.
From using lorries to go to work he over a short period pushed the purchase of staff buses.”
Workers said Dr Zinyemba’s sudden death took them by surprise and said they will remember his positive impact on the business.
“His death has dealt a blow to his vision.
He was trying his best that we can’t deny,” said Mr Gerald Ndlovu, another worker.
Contacted for comment, Mines Parliamentary Portfolio Committee chairman, Edmond Mkaratigwa, said during his tenure at the helm of HCCL, Dr Zinyemba steered the colliery firm to positive growth.
“We are saddened that we have lost a mining sector veteran and cadre who proved to have been managing to steward his staff and use the available resources to change the course of the ship to positive growth and profitability from negativity and losses,” he said.
“Such leadership was key for Hwange, which required innovation and maximisation in the backdrop of climate change impacts and governance frameworks discouraging its use globally.”
Mr Mkaratigwa said Dr Zinyemba had a listening ear and mastered the art of engaging as he cooperated with key stakeholders while being open to criticism.
Dr Zinyemba was a holder of an Executive Master of Business Administration Degree from the National University of Science and Technology (Nust), MBChB from the University of Zimbabwe and was a full member of the College of Primary Care Physicians of Zimbabwe and an Associate Member of the Institute of Directors of Zimbabwe.
The late Dr Zinyemba has a background in the military where he worked as a medical doctor before being employed by the colliery as its medical services manager.
He was appointed acting managing director in 2018 following the departure of Mr Thomas Makore and the subsequent placing of the company under administration.
Dr Zinyemba was confirmed as the coal mining company’s substantive managing director last year, a position he held to his untimely death. Burial details are yet to be disclosed. Chronicle

Soldiers Bash Villagers

Dozens of villagers near Jason Ziyaphapha Moyo Airbase in Chegutu were on Tuesday allegedly assaulted by soldiers reportedly searching for a machete gangster who had assaulted their collegue.
According to pictures seen by NewsDay, the assaulted villagers sustained injuries on their faces, heads, legs and hands.

Some of the assault victims received medical attention at Chegutu General Hospital, according to a medical report in possession of NewsDay.

Contacted for comment, Air Force of Zimbabwe spokesperson Squadron leader Donovan Muroyiwa said he was yet to receive the report, but said an investigation had already been launched to ascertain the claims.

Villagers said the soldiers stormed their homes at around 11pm, inquiring the whereabouts of a machete gangster who had allegedly been involved in an altercation with their colleague.

The soldiers, reportedly armed with guns and knobkerries, damaged doors to gain entry to villagers’ houses. They also stormed a homestead where villagers were attending a funeral and harassed mourners.

“They were beating everyone who professed ignorance of the whereabouts of the alleged gangster,” one villager said, adding they were now living in fear.

“It was around 11pm when a loud bang at the door woke me up. At first, I thought they were thieves until I saw soldiers clad in uniform. They accused us of hiding their suspect.”

Another villager said: “I saw two truckloads of soldiers, who were dropping off at various homesteads, interrogating and assaulting villagers over the whereabouts of a man who injured a soldier with a knife.

“I witnessed the altercation between the soldier and the man. They had a misunderstanding over a woman while drinking beer at a local bar.”

National police spokesperson Assistant Commissioner Paul Nyathi said he had not yet received the report.

In December, a soldier shot and killed five people at a shopping centre in Mhondoro after a misunderstanding with a villager. —Newsday

Census Results To Come After 3 Months

Preliminary results of the 2022 population and housing census held last month will be released in August this year, the Zimbabwe National Statistics Agency (ZimStat) has said.

The 2022 population and housing census ran from April 21 to 30, 2022, while a mop-up exercise was completed on May 6, 2022.

ZimStat spokesperson Mercy Chidemo told NewsDay that the 2022 population census had been digitised to enhance quick data processing, which would see the results being released within a shorter period compared to previous years.

“The preliminary results are expected in the next three months, which is in August,” Chidemo said.

“We will have a full report by December. We will do a post-enumeration survey to assess the quality of our data. The process will be made easier by digitalising it. Using the digital system, we are currently detecting errors on demography which will then be verified and rectified by our enumerators. So the three-month period is actually shorter than the three years that it would take to release the results in previous years.”

The 2022 population census was marred by irregularities which included involvement of the members of the security services and Zanu PF youths, as well as delayed payment of enumerators, among others.

Some enumerators claim that they have not yet received their allowances almost two weeks after the exercise.

However, teachers who took part in the process as enumerators told NewsDay that they were paid $320 000 for the 20 days they took part in the census, which is far more than their monthly salaries. -Newsday

Why Formula Milk Should Not Replace Breastfeeding

Formula milk companies are paying social media platforms and influencers to gain direct access to pregnant women and mothers at some of the most vulnerable moments in their lives. The global formula milk industry, valued at some US$ 55 billion, is targeting new mothers with personalized social media content that is often not recognizable as advertising.

A new World Health Organization (WHO) report titled Scope and impact of digital marketing strategies for promoting breast-milk substitutes has outlined the digital marketing techniques designed to influence the decisions new families make on how to feed their babies.

Through tools like apps, virtual support groups or ‘baby-clubs’, paid social media influencers, promotions and competitions and advice forums or services, formula milk companies can buy or collect personal information and send personalized promotions to new pregnant women and mothers.

The report summarizes findings of new research that sampled and analyzed 4 million social media posts about infant feeding published between January and June 2021 using a commercial social listening platform. These posts reached 2.47 billion people and generated more than 12 million likes, shares or comments.

Formula milk companies post content on their social media accounts around 90 times per day, reaching 229 million users; representing three times as many people as are reached by informational posts about breastfeeding from non-commercial accounts.

This pervasive marketing is increasing purchases of breast-milk substitutes and therefore dissuading mothers from breastfeeding exclusively as recommended by WHO.

“The promotion of commercial milk formulas should have been terminated decades ago,” said Dr Francesco Branca, Director of the WHO Nutrition and Food Safety department. “The fact that formula milk companies are now employing even more powerful and insidious marketing techniques to drive up their sales is inexcusable and must be stopped.”

The report compiled evidence from social listening research on public online communications and individual country reports of research that monitors breast-milk substitute promotions, as well as drawing on a recent multi-country study of mothers’ and health professionals’ experiences of formula milk marketing. The studies show how misleading marketing reinforces myths about breastfeeding and breast milk and undermines women’s confidence in their ability to breastfeed successfully.

The proliferation of global digital marketing of formula milk blatantly breaches the International Code of Marketing of Breast-milk Substitutes (the Code), which was adopted by the 1981 World Health Assembly.

The Code is a landmark public health agreement designed to protect the general public and mothers from aggressive marketing practices by the baby food industry that negatively impact breastfeeding practices.

Despite clear evidence that exclusive and continued breastfeeding are key determinants of improved lifelong health for children, women and communities, far too few children are breastfed as recommended. If current formula milk marketing strategies continue, that proportion could fall still further, boosting companies’ profits.

The fact that these forms of digital marketing can evade scrutiny from national monitoring and health authorities means new approaches to Code-implementing regulation and enforcement are required. Currently, national legislation may be evaded by marketing that originates beyond borders.

WHO has called on the baby food industry to end exploitative formula milk marketing, and on governments to protect new children and families by enacting, monitoring and enforcing laws to end all advertising or other promotion of formula milk products.

Source: World Health Organization

AIRPORT RD CONTRACT: Mnangagwa Says-You Can’t Sue Me In Any Way

The legal wrangle over the Airport road construction contract has seen statements being made that Emmerson Mnangagwa cannot be sued in any way.

NewsdzeZimbabwe
Our Zimbabwe Our News

Home

Wednesday, 11 May 2022
AIRPORT ROAD SAGA SETTLED

An application filed by legislator Allan Markham against Aurgur Investments and President Mnangagwa over the transfer of deed of settlement by the City of Harare was yesterday dismissed by the High Court.
Markham who is the applicant together with Tavonga Savings Scheme and Jacob Pikicha were represented by Advocate Eric Matinenga while the respondents who are cited as Augur Investments, Tatiana Aleshina, Michael Van Blerk, City of Harare, Local Government Minister July Moyo, Doorex Properties, Registrar of Deeds and the President of Zimbabwe. First to ninth respondents were being represented by Advocate Tawanda Zhuwarara.

According to State papers, on May 30, 2008 Aurgur Investments entered into a written contract with the City of Harare and according to terms of the contract, Augur was to construct Joshua Mqabuko Nkomo Road (Airport Road). It is said 90 percent of the construction costs would be paid in the form of land while 10 percent would be paid in cash.

The papers indicate that upon satisfaction of the consulting engineers, the City of Harare would instruct conveyancers to transfer land to Augur for work done.

Harare City Council however abruptly cancelled the agreement and this prompted Augur to demand a penalty payment of 35 percent of the value of the land supplied as a penalty fee.

Augur’s position was that it is entitled to a 35 percent termination fee and it sued under HC 598/17 demanding 35 percent termination fee.

The 35 percent termination fee was identified as Stand 654 Pomona Township, Harare, measuring 40,665 hectares in extent.

Augur instituted arbitration proceedings seeking that it be declared the owner of Stand 654 Pomona Township, Harare and that the City of Harare and the Minister of Local Government, Public Works & National Housing be directed to sign all documents to enable transfer to Augur of Stand 654 Pomona Township, Harare. The judge entered an award of US$3 million in Augur’s favour.

However, the City of Harare challenged the arbitral award, but Augur appealed the decision and the parties settled the dispute in the form of deed of settlement.

It was this deed of settlement that was challenged by Markham and other applicants. They argued that the deed of settlement should be declared null and void.

The applicants then also sued President Mnangagwa in violation of Rule 18 of the High Court Rules, 1971. The rule was in existence when the suit was filed.

The rule reads: “No summons or other civil process of the court may be issued out against the President or against any of the judges of the High Court without the leave of the court granted on a court application being made for that purpose.”

Advocate Zhuwarara challenged Markham and others saying for them to sue the President or any of the judges of the court they must apply and seek leave of the court to sue any of those public officials.

The applicants concede that they sued the President without having obtained leave of the court to do so. They submitted orally that there is a difference between citing the President in his personal capacity and citing him in his nominal capacity.

However, Justice David Mangota in a judgement yesterday ruled that the respondents had no authority to sue the respondents.

The judge said the applicants sued President Mnangagwa in violation of rule 18 of the high court rules.

The rule says no summons or other civil processes of the court may be issued against the President or against any of the judges of the High Court without the leave of the court granted on a court application being made for that purpose.

“The respondents succeed in all the three in limine matters which they raised. They showed that the application which sued the President of zimbabwe without leave of the court is fatally defective and cannot therefore stand. They showed further that the applicants lacked the locus standi to sue the respondents and that the suit which was brought against them was fraught with material disputes of fact which cannot be resolved on the papers. The application is therefore dismissed with costs,” ruled Justice Mangota.

Advocate Zhuwarara had challenged the applicants saying they do not qualify or locus standi to sue the respondents.

Justice Mangota concurred with Advocate Zhuwarara saying the locus is not established by argument as Markham seeking to do.

Locus manifests itself from an effortless reading of the founding papers of the plaintiff in an action, or the applicant in motion, proceedings. It is a logical consequence of the cause of action of the plaintiff or the applicant against the defendant or the respondent,” JusticeMangota ruled.

He said he was satisfied that applicants who are total strangers to the respondents do not have the requisite locus to sue the latter.

He further ruled that their suit is akin to a leap into the dark, so to speak. It hanged on nothing. It was therefore completely devoid of merit.

The judge further said they should have realized that the serious allegations which they levelled against the respondents would seriously be contested by the latter. – State Media Additional reporting

Mahere Says Zimbabwe Shut For Business

Opposition Citizens Coalition for Change (CCC) party yesterday accused President Emmerson Mnangagwa of “shutting off” the country to business through chaotic anti-economic measures.

Fadzayi Mahere

Addressing a Press conference in Harare yesterday, CCC spokesperson Fadzayi Mahere said the cocktail of measures announced by Mnangagwa on Saturday had caused bloodbath in business corridors.

“His mantra when he got into power was ‘Zimbabwe is open for business’, but Mnangagwa has effectively closed the country for business. Most commercial actors have already warned that the lending freeze would hurt Zimbabwe’s already fragile economy,” Mahere said.

“Mnangagwa did not produce any facts or figures to justify the lending ban. This has created fresh uncertainty to the already uncertain economy.”

Mnangagwa on Saturday directed banks to stop lending, among other measures aimed at controlling the galloping exchange rate and arresting the continued fall of the local currency.

The stabilisation measures have attracted widespread criticism from business and industry, with legal experts saying they were a legal nullity.

“What Mnangagwa demonstrated is that he has no care whatsoever for the welfare of citizens. He is not in touch with the reality of commerce in Zimbabwe. What we need to solve the entirety of these problems is to ensure that we install a government that serves the people and not just a few,” Mahere said.

“The measures can be best described as an assault on trade, an assault on commerce which will obviously be felt the most by the ordinary citizen on the street.”

The outspoken opposition information tsar said through his Saturday nocturnal policies, Mnangagwa had usurped the Constitution.

“There is simply no law that allows even the Reserve Bank of Zimbabwe to suspend all lending, to interfere with private contracts, to interfere with commerce to the point of hampering and halting all business activities,” Mahere said.

The Zimbabwe National Chamber of Commerce has also shredded Mnangagwa’s economic stabilisation measures as unworkable. –Newsday

Man Steals $1 mln From Civil Servants

A man from Bulawayo’s Pelandaba suburb is on the run after defrauding scores of civil servants of more than $1 million in undelivered household and electrical goods.
Munyaradzi Mundingi (38) was allegedly targeting civil servants via WhatsApp groups claiming he owned a company that supplied goods on credit.

Bulawayo police spokesperson Assistant Inspector Nomalanga Msebele said it later turned out that the company did not exist.

“The accused person is the owner of a bogus company named Pro-Plus Africa Investments which is currently operating as a credit facility company offering credit facilities to unsuspecting people in and around Zimbabwe. On numerous occasions the accused person would approach his victims through the country where he would offer them credit facilities to purchase electrical gadgets and household implements like solar panels, inverters and batteries among other things,” said Asst Insp Msebele.

“The accused would also fish his victims via a WhatsApp platform called News Report 789 where he would post advertisements of the so-called products he purported to be offering on credit and the terms and conditions there off applying for one to qualify to benefit from the credit facility.”

She said Mundingi would process documentation and ensure that the civil servants salaries were deducted to his account by the Salary Service Bureau (SSB).

Asst Insp Msebele said the victims only discovered that they had been duped when their products were not being delivered.

“Deductions will be effected on the victim’s salaries through SSB into the accused person’s account. Thereafter, the victims would wait for their goods which would be according to the terms and conditions supposed to be delivered soon after the first instalment having been deducted but the accused would never deliver the goods,” said Insp Msebele.

“As a result of this cunning and fraudulent act the accused has swindled more than 100 victims of their hard-earned money cash worth millions of Zimbabwean dollars. On discovering that they had been duped by this accused person many victims have since filed reports with the police. Investigations have been carried out by the police only to discover that this company called Pro-Plus is non-existent in the companies registry records however, it is operating as a shadow company of Red Sphere which is duly registered.”

She said Mundingi can longer be located and police are seeking information from the public that will result in his arrest.

Asst Insp Msebele said those with information that may lead to his arrest can report to their nearest police station or police Commercial Crimes Division Southern Region on landline 0292-278615. -Chronicle

July Moyo Under Spotlight Over Devolution Funds

By A Correspondent- Citizens Coalition for Change (CCC) Manicaland chairperson, Proper Mutseyami has accused local government minister July Moyo of abusing devolution funds.

Mutseyami said Moyo was deliberately delaying the disbursement of the funds to local authorities so as he can keep embezzling the money.

The Dangamvura-Chikanga legislator said this during a constituency indaba recently convened by the Zimbabwe Coalition on Debt and Development (ZIMCODD) in Mutare.

The Indaba brought together councillors and residents in Dangamvura-Chikanga constituency to discuss devolution and road rehabilitation.

During the Indaba residents expressed deep concern over poor workmanship on the roads that were recently upgraded in the border town, some of which have been marred by potholes within a short space of time.

“Minister (July Moyo) is deliberately delaying the enactment of a devolution enabling Act so that they use that legal gap to keep abusing funds. The problem with devolution right now is that there is no Act which enables the law enshrined in the constitution to be implemented. Devolution is just a mere talk because there is no an enabling Act,” Mutseyami said.

He noted that most devolution funds that are being disbursed especially for road rehabilitation are being abused as contractors are normally roped in without following proper tender procedures.

Amongst members of parliament there is a view that devolution funds are not properly utilised in the designated provinces. These funds must be used to embark on big projects like building new roads, hospitals and schools.

“Ministry determines how these funds may be used without involvement of councillors. Councillors will be just told that there is a certain company that has come to spruce up roads yet these must go through a tender,” said Mutseyami.

He added: “A few people determine the company to construct roads yet those companies do not have adequate equipment to perform such a job. For example if you look at Jeff road, it was commissioned in March but it now has got a lot of potholes.”

Mutseyami further urged Moyo to urgently come up with an enabling Act in order to strictly monitor the allocation of devolution funds.

“This country voted for councillors who are supposed to form a provincial council in 2018. Up to now those provincial councillors have not started working and constituted, yet they are being paid every month.

“The minister is responsible for facilitating so that we have that Act. That is why we have an outcry of devolution funds because we have a legal grey area,” he said.

Large sums of money have been disbursed country-wide by government since President Emmerson Mnangagwa took over in 2017. All these funds have been disbursed without legal monitoring or evaluation structures in place.

One “ Pfura ” Ward 40 BUT too many of Similar Wards for CCC in Mash Central

By Tinashe Gumbo  | Traditionally, by-elections have never attracted much public interest in Zimbabwean politics. However, the successive by-elections that were held on 26 March and 7 May 2022 have generated a lot of debates and interest among political activists, analysts and the media.

The country held an almost mini-general election on 26 March 2022 following massive recalls of legislators and Councilors by the Movement for Democratic Change (MDC) led by Senator Douglas Mwonzora as well as some few deaths and reassignments of incumbents. This was followed by yet another by-election process on 7 May 2022 held in Rusape Ward 5, Chitungwiza Ward 7, Kariba Ward 3,4 and 8, Mutare Ward 14 and 16 as well as Pfura Ward 40.

The results of these by-elections have largely been described as a mirror of the 2023 harmonized elections. The excellent performance by one of the “newly” established opposition parties, the Citizens Coalition for Change (CCC) surprised many, while “old” opposition players such as the MDC’s dismal show confirmed what the majority in the opposition circles wished for after the 2020 Supreme Court Ruling. On it’s part, the Zimbabwe African National Union Patriotic Front (ZANU PF) also celebrated its retention of mostly the rural vote but also its victory in Epworth.

Of particular interest for this piece, is the by-election result from Pfura Ward 40 of Mt Darwin in Mashonaland Central. The ward was won by the ZANU PF with a huge margin. The CCC performance in that Ward almost distorted its general show of popularity witnessed on 26 March and on 7 May in the rest of the contested wards and constituencies.

Pfura Ward 40 results emerged as one talking point from the 7 May by-election. The discussion is on why the opposition lost that “one” when all the other seven wards were responsive to the CCC. The CCC won almost 88% (seven out of eight) of the wards on offer. The ZANU PF scooped this “special” ward from Pfura while the game remained tough for the MDC which maintained its “zero” trend from the first match played on 26 March.

_Pfura_ _Ward_ _40_ _is_ _in_ _Mashonaland_ _Central_ _!_

It is critical to quickly remind each other that Pfura is located in Mashonaland Central. The province remains a major challenge for the opposition parties to perform meaningfully. Even from the days of the “MDC”, I mean the undivided MDC of 1999 to 2004, the game had not been easy in that pitch as the opposition virtually failed to break ZANU PF’s defense in that province. At best, the opposition won “something” in 2008 during the days of the likes of Shepherd Mushonga and some few Councilors in Bindura and Mvurwi in the recent years. Otherwise, generally, the opposition continues to struggle in the province.

Therefore, the Pfura Ward 40 result of 7 May 2022 should not be a surprise. It should be understood within the broader context affecting the whole province. The result, should indeed allow the opposition to sit down and reflect about its performance in such strategic provinces as the country gears up for the 2023 plebiscite.

_The_ _Results_ _at_ _a_ _Glance_

The ZANU PF Candidate in Pfura Ward 40, Gift Madziwa, polled 1461 votes while the CCC’s Candidate, Tobias Samuel scored 77 votes. The total vote cast was 1557 where 1538 were valid. The voter population in that ward was 3905 giving us a 39.9% voter turnout for that election. While the turnout was not generally impressive, the gap between the two contestants should be a big cause for worry on the part of the opposition, beyond the CCC. The two-digit figure is not something to celebrate about at all. If maintained, the figure will likely lead to the scaring away of potential supporters as they will not have confidence in that party.

_Any_ _Change_ _from_ _the_ _past_ _?_

Certainly, no changes from history. The trend has been sustained in the province in general in terms of electoral performance by the ruling and the opposition parties. The trend was maintained in Mt Darwin and in the entire province. For instance, in 2015, ZANU PF’s by-election Candidate in Mt Darwin West National House of Assembly, Barnwell Seremwe polled 18 315 against the Transform Zimbabwe and the National Constitutional Assembly’s candidates who scored 302 and 216 respectively. The seat had fallen vacant following the elevation of Dr Joyce Teurairopa Mujuru to the position of Vice President in 2013, before she was fired the following year due to internal factional wars in her party.

In the same constituency, ZANU PF had scored 22 877 votes in 2013 elections. Therefore, Pfura Ward 40 feeds from the mother constituencies of Mt Darwin and the grandmother (Mashonaland Central province). Pfura Ward 40 learnt every trick of it from the constituency and the province. Other wards and constituencies across the province have also benefited from this trend.

_But_ _why_ _is_ _Mashonaland_ _Central_ _Difficult_ _for_ _the_ _Opposition_ _?_

The opposition political parties should try to answer this question in their boardrooms as they plot for Mashonaland Central province. They should be contending that on 7 May 2022, they faced a single “Pfura” ward and indeed, in 2023, there will be hundreds of these “Pfura” wards in Mt Darwin; Rushinga; Mvurwi; Centenary; Shamva; Bindura; Mazowe; Guruve and Muzarabani. The “Pfura” wards will be too much for the opposition. Better be prepared! Better learn from 7 May test case and improve.

I always tell people that profiling of these wards, constituencies, provinces and subsequent planning accordingly is the answer to opposition headache. The opposition should clearly understand the historic, political, economic, cultural and social terrain of these areas. Certainly, by now, the opposition should have learnt and improved, but alas, they are yet to “get it” and act as per the dictates of these strategic provinces.

_A_ _little_ _bit_ _about_ _the_ _province_ :

1. I am convinced that personalities count in politics. Heavyweights’ names in a political party have a direct bearing on an election outcome. Prominent ZANU PF figures from Mashonaland Central have continued to “influence” elections held in that province. Interestingly, some of them are doing so in death and in exile as well as in their private lives. Their shadows and history continue to haunt the people of Mashonaland Central. A mere mention of their names automatically informs the voter of where to put his or her vote on election day.

However, some are still breathing politically and biologically. The list of big names that continue to haunt voters in the province is very long: Dr Mujuru; the late Elliot Manyika; the first lady Dr Auxilia Mnangagwa of Chiweshe; Savior Kasukuwere who is in exile; the late Border Gezi; Nicholas Goche; Lazarus Dokora; Christopher Kuruneri; Chenhamo Chakezha Chimutengwende; the late Vice President Joseph Musika of Chiweshe, Major Cairo Mhandu and the new and emerging names in the politics of that province such as Kazembe Kazembe; Tafadzwa Musarara, Martin Dhina and some more progressive but politically influential such as the likes of Fortune Chasi among others.

Studies have confirmed that voters tend to want to protect the political positions of their national leaders. Thus, they will always listen to the political advice from those who come from their local communities but also holding national political positions. Remember the positions held by many of these leaders at national level both in the ZANU PF party and in Cabinet and Presidium. Most of these were and some are still in Cabinet while others hold key party positions at national level.

Remember Gezi, Manyika and Kasukuwere roles in the national Commissariat of ZANU PF. Remember the role played by Goche as the Negotiator for the Inclusive Government and his role in Cabinet. Mujuru-Musika Presidium roles too. Kazembe-Dokora-Kuruneri-Chenhamo-Chasi and others’ Ministerial posts. These figures virtually ran the country from Mashonaland Central.

During an election season, these powerful positions are utilized in mobilizing vote for that party. Powerful position come with political, material and financial power hence motivation for voting towards that party.

One will argue that the same can be tried by the CCC, MDC or any other party. A number of senior political figures in the opposition come from particular rural wards and constituencies. Their local community members envy them for holding those national positions even though they are still in opposition. Why not ensure that these national leaders virtually camp in their rural wards during elections to campaign for their local candidates? They have the national political flavor just like their ZANU PF counterparts. Certainly, some changes can be noted, at least for the national Presidential vote.

2. Mashonaland Central saw a number of families accessing land during the “land redistribution program”. This remains a tool for winning elections in the province. It is good that some of the key opposition parties are now beginning to emphasize that “land reform” is an irreversible process. We heard this from the CCC in Masvingo-and this can be the right way to go. Such messages should be heard more in provinces such as Mashonaland Central. This policy framework should be amplified in the upcoming elections.

I read a twitter post by Chalton Hwende the Secretary General of the CCC on 24 April 2022 elaborating on the land reform issue in the context of his party’s campaign in Pfura Ward 40. He indicated that “Ward 40 in Mt Darwin has a lot of resettlement areas. The situation in farming communities is changing. In 2001, 82.4% of beneficiaries got land through land invasions but by 2015, 50.0% was now through inheritance (young people who are cash focused and hungry for change)”.

While such analysis maybe be true and helpful in strategy development for a campaign, communicating it publicly may be dangerous especially when dealing with ZANU PF in Mashonaland Central. One can easily expose his or her party supporters who will be then targeted by the opponent(ZANU PF). Opposition parties should learn (and learn well) from ZANU PF-it will not publicise its strategic data, let alone its strategy. In areas such as Mashonaland Central, underground tactics will certainly bear better fruits than open actions.

3. The ZANU PF maximizes history. There have been strong messages that portray the people of Mashonaland Central as the “main victims” of the effects of the liberation war. People are reminded of such and such battle fought in Muzarabani, in Mt Darwin or Guruve because of the proximity of these areas to Mozambique. Yes, these were among the key entry points for liberation fighters into the country but surely not the only ones. People are also always reminded of Charwe Nyakasikana (Mbuya Nehanda) as having been from Mazowe.

Surely, such messages can be neutralized and countered by the opposition, if they are really serious about wrestling the province from ZANU PF. Noone should monopolise the “victimness” of the area. Noone should monopolise history. History belongs to all of us hence Mbuya Nehanda should be for all of us despite our contemporary political differences.

4. In 2000 Constitutional Referendum, Mashonaland Central was one of the areas which generally supported the YES vote. They voted for the Government sponsored Constitutional Draft when the majority rejected it.

The YES received 578 000 votes against 697 754 NO votes nationally. The Mashonaland Central province received showers of praise from the ZANU PF party and Government leaders. Therefore, this remained a signature historical performance that ZANU PF wants to protect. Reference has always been made during political rallies that “Mashonaland Central defended the country from the imperialists in 2000”.

5. The Chibondo (Mt Darwin) exhumation and “reburials” of the people alleged to have been killed during the liberation war time by the whites might have been another contributor to the general feeling towards ZANU PF in the area. The exhumations and reburials took place around 2011 being led by the ZANU PF leadership under the cover of the Fallen Heroes Trust. Those 849 bodies which were exhumed in Mt Darwin were paraded for the community members to see.

The exercise was so emotional that community members would not have “voted otherwise” in the subsequent elections. It was presented as an example of the white man’s (and woman) impunity as the Rhodesian Government “attempted to suppress the will of the people” during the liberation war.

6. The NHANGA-GOTA exercise has been used by the first lady to garner up support for the ruling party. These so-called traditional meetings have been concentrated in the province and they have mobilized potential “voters” through the traditional leaders and party structures. It is likely that this exercise will bring huge numbers of supporters to ZANU PF for 2023. While the process has been regarded as a form of some philanthropic work, no doubt, it has some political results which are falling onto the ZANU PF plate.

7. But the serious political violence against the opposition political parties’ membership perpetrated by alleged ZANU PF sympathizers also continues to be a factor that influences the election results in the province.

Remember the Elliot Pfebve (MDC) Vs Elliot Manyika (Battle of the Elliots) fierce violence filled campaign. The campaign for the Bindura seat that had fell vacant following the death of Border Gezi in a car accident along Masvingo road was violent. The violence psychologically affected the voters to this day.

8. During the early days of the formation of the MDC, Elliot Pfebve’s brother Matthew was killed in Mt Darwin in 2000, the same period when other first MDC victims, Tichaona Chiminya and Talent Mabika were burnt to death in Manicaland. Furthermore, the murder of Trymore Midzi, another MDC activist and the subsequent battle of Bindura (between the ZANU PF supporters and the mainly MDC mourners during his burial) in 2002 was another notable key incident in the province. All these bring back memories of violence that influence election outcomes. The memories continue to linger in the voters’ minds and obviously reminding them to “vote wisely”.

9. It has also been noted that Mt Darwin has been one of the ZANU PF defined districts which did well with regards to the party’s voter mobilization campaign during their internal leadership renewal processes in 2021. Such internal processes help mobilize and motivate party structures even for external elections. The ZANU PF machinery is effective and very efficient when it comes to mobilisation, coordination and activation of party structures. By the way, the party is known for its massive audit and verification exercises for its structures. It was noted that Mazowe and Mt Darwin districts did very well in this regard during ZANU PF’s internal processes last year. The results were seen on 7 May 22 in Pfura Ward 40.

The ZANU PF is disciplined when it comes to ensuring that after internal elective processes, all supporters are whipped into party line, ready for supporting each other against the opposition. It has the ability to “resolve” differences after every internal process. Remember, the Musarara-Kazembe-James Makamba fierce battle for provincial chairmanship. Yet, in all the by-elections that followed in Bindura (26 March) and in Pfura Ward 40, one could not tell that there was once such feud among major factions.

_Conclusion_

While there is overwhelming evidence to explain the dismal performance of the opposition parties in Mashonaland Central, there is still room for them to improve. Instead of wasting time campaigning in urban areas where they are assured of a win, they should invest time and other resources in this hard to win province.

Otherwise, the CCC’s impressive show of popularity during the two by-elections, barely four months after its formation, is something to commend. The MDC needs to go back to the drawing board and find the right formula for this game. The ZANU PF also did well in its defense of traditional territories. Yet, there will be many “Pfura” wards and constituencies for the opposition parties to contend with. A lasting solution should be sought when dealing with the Mashonaland Central case.

Gvt Bailout For Struggling PSMAS

By A Correspondent- Struggling medical insurance company Premier Medical Aid Society (PSMAS) will receive a government bailout to clear its debts and improve its balance sheet, vice president Constantino Chiwenga said on Tuesday.

Chiwenga, who is also the health minister, said government employees who make up most of PSMAS’ 900,000 customers were struggling to obtain medical services on the strength of a PSMAS health insurance policy.

He said in many instances, hospitals and pharmacies were refusing to honour the membership card, citing non-payment of claims submitted to PSMAS. This has resulted in PSMAS policy holders being required to make payments up-front, often in foreign currency.

Where PSMAS medical aid cards are accepted, significant co-payments are also required, both in respect of consultation fees and the purchase of prescription drugs, he said.

“The government has committed additional financial resources on a monthly basis to ensure the viability of PSMAS and PSMI to deliver on their core mandate. The funds are targeted to retire the debt to PSMI and other third-party service providers,” Chiwenga said, without disclosing the size of the bailout.

“That support will extend to PSMI to pay its workforce and procure adequate medical drugs consistently.”

He said PSMAS had confirmed to the government that it had accumulated significant debts with service providers.

“Concerned about the failure by employees to access health services posed by this situation, the government urged PSMAS to use a significant proportion of the money from the national treasury to retire the debt owed to the service providers in order to restore the integrity of the PSMAS medical aid card used by employees to access health services,” Chiwenga said.

“The restoration of trust will also remove the distress caused by huge shortfalls to service providers that would require civil servants to find the money for co-payments.”

Chiwenga assured government workers, who form 90 percent of contributions to PSMAS, that “the government’s support for their healthcare needs remains intact and unwavering.”

“In addition, effective measures have been and will continue to be undertaken to secure the character and viability of PSMAS which most of them depend on for healthcare services,” he said.

The government currently supports each employee who chooses to become a PSMAS member by paying 80 percent of the subscriptions translating to at least US$5 million in employer contribution monthly and US$60 million annually.

-zimlive

Firm Slapped With Fine for Fraud

CONSULTANCY company Philjoy Secretarial Services has been fined $30 000 for fraud after crafting a fake CR14.
Harare magistrate Munashe Chibanda ordered the company to pay the fine or have its property attached.

The court heard that on a date unknown to the prosecutor, but during the period between July 29, 2002 and August 2020 and at the Registrar of Companies office, Harare, the company represented by Phillip Danga sought to mislead the public that it had been appointed company secretary of Balwearie Holdings (Pvt) Limited.

It is alleged that Danga prepared a fraudulent CR14 document and filed the same with the Register of Companies offices.

He pleaded not guilty to the charge.

Danga further told the court that the CR14 was prepared by his clerk, and that he was only given the document to sign.

After a full trial, Chibanda said the State managed to prove a prima facie case against the company.

“It is common cause that the CR14 is full of misrepresentations. The Registrar of Companies clearly told the court that it was the duty of the accused to supply correct information. The State has managed to prove its case beyond reasonable doubt that the accused committed the offence. I, hereby, find the accused guilty,” Chibanda ruled. -Newsday

Nyanga Man Fined For Wearing Red

By- A 76-year-old Nyanga man was recently fined after his 15-year-old grandson was convicted for allegedly violating an odd traditional custom of wearing red colours during the rainy season.

Fungai Mushonga, the Headman for Tamunesa village in Nyanga District in Manicaland province on 7 January 2022 took the unprecedented and bizarre decision in which he ordered 76-year-old Peter Makunura to pay four goats, two chickens and US$20 after faulting him for allowing his 15-year-old grandson, who had visited him, to wear a red cap during the rainy season, a practice which is outlawed in the village.

Makunura was also charged for undermining authority of the Headman by not presenting himself at a primary court session, where he was supposed to answer to the frivolous charges.

The 76-year-old Makunura has now engaged Kelvin Kabaya and Peggy Tavagadza of Zimbabwe Lawyers for Human Rights, who recently filed an application for review of the proceedings presided over by Mushonga and seeking to set aside the absurd decision of the primary court.
In the application, Kabaya and Tavagadza argued that Mushonga’s decision to summon a minor child to appear in court without his guardian and to permit the Messenger of Court to attach and take into execution Makunura’s property, when he was never a party to the proceedings and was never summoned to appear in the primary court, was grossly irregular as to amount to an illegality.
The human rights lawyers also contended that the decision by Mushonga to enter a judgment in default in circumstances involving a minor child was grossly irregular as to induce a sense of shock and revulsion.
Kabaya and Tavagadza want Mushonga’s judgment to be set aside and that he be ordered to pay back the four goats, two chickens and US$20 to Makunura.
In his defence, Mushonga, who is opposing the application, argued that it is taboo in his jurisdiction for his subjects to “wear red clothing during the rainy season” and that he could not ascertain the age of Makunura’s grandson for him to realise that he was a minor.
Nyanga Magistrate Notebulgar Muchineripi is yet to hand down judgment on Makunura’s application.
In some communities, it is believed that wearing red clothes when it is raining attracts lightning.

Deputy Agric Minister Karoro Implicated in Presidential Inputs Fraud

By Jane Mlambo| The deputy minister of the ministry of lands, water and agriculture Honourable Douglas Karoro is implicated in a case where GMB was prejudiced of US$24 000.

The Mbire legislator is said to have acted in connivance with Mugove Glen Chidamba to sell bags of fertilizers meant to benefit local farmers under the Presidential Inputs Programme, according to court papers obtained by this publication.

“On the 25th day of April 2022, the accused with the assistance of Honourable Douglas Karoro, received 400 x 50kg Ammonium Nitrate fertilizers from GMB Aspindale, which was supposed to be transported to GMB Mushumbi and benefit local farmers under the Presidential Inputs Programme.

“The accused then sold 200 bags to different customers in Harare and did not deliver the fertilizer to GMB Mushumbi,” the state alleges.

When the GMB Aspindale manager learnt that the consignment had not reached GMB Mushumbi Depot he quizzed the deputy agriculture minister who then hatched a plan with the accused Chidamba to conceal the fraud.

“To cover up for the offense accused returned 200 bags of Ammonium Nitrate ,132 x 50kg Super Fert, Calcium Ammonium Nitrate   and 69 x 50kg Super Fert, Cotton Top Dressing Calcium Ammonium Nitrate misrepresenting that it was the same fertilizer they had collected from the same Depot on 25 April 2022,” added the state.

However, the defense lawyer representing Chidamba argued that the accused was being sacrificed when it was clear that it is the deputy minister Karoro who should be answering the charges since he is the one who had contacted GMB.

The lawyer is seeking bail and the ruling for the bail application has been set for   Wednesday.
